A WWII German lithographic propaganda poster Vinnytsia Massacre issued for occupied Ukrainian territories about atrocities committed by Communists in Vinnytsia. The poster depicts a Jewish Commissar towering over a mass grave at Vinnytsia in Ukraine, circa 1943. The massacre was used by the Germans to discredit the Soviet Union. Titled in Ukrainian lower to the center. Marked, P 132 Winniza Judischer Kommissar Ukrainisch, lower right.
